🔧 Maintenance
Service Intervals
Oil Change Frequency:
Typically every 7,500-10,000 miles (12,000-16,000 km) or annually
Spark Plug Replacement:
Refer to manual for specific intervals based on engine type
Timing Belt Replacement:
Crucial; typically every 60,000 miles (100,000 km) or 5 years for M20/M40 engines
Fluid Specifications
Engine Oil Grade:
Typically 10W-40 or 5W-40 synthetic, depending on climate and engine variant
Coolant Type:
BMW Blue/Green Antifreeze/Coolant (ethylene glycol based)
Brake Fluid Type:
DOT 3 or DOT 4
Known Issues
Common E30 Faults:
Cooling system leaks (hoses, radiator), fuel pump failures, idle control valve issues, door seal degradation, rust (fender arches, sills)
Wiring Harness Durability:
Age-related degradation of engine bay wiring harnesses can lead to electrical gremlins
